A young man who has just taken the oath of allegiance as anAmerican citizen takes a trip back to Africa, in his homeland Kenya, and this trip ends up giving his life a mission. With the advantage of being an insider (having been born and grown up in Nairobi) and outsider (having resided in the United States of America for more than ten years), the author takes the reader on an experiential appreciation of corruption and its faces in his immediate environment. It is a reflective account of how the writer travels the corridors of time into his childhood and back to adulthood, to appreciate how things have so changed; only to remain the same; in some instances, completely the same. When Poets Influenced the World Randy Goss
Books with a 0 star rating(0)
$11.84
Size: 5.83" x 8.26"
Binding: Perfect Bound
This is the paperback version for readers who want something to hold, something personal they can carry and write notes in. It includes some of the information from the websites mentioned in the book to make it easier on the reader. The book takes a backward look at where the influence of poetry began in government and into today. It reveals some of what governmental leaders such as J.F.K said of authors and poetry and their necessary input. From the book, the reader can see the spiritual, the normal and the governmental influence of poetry. It may call the poet back to meaningful writing, more than an emotional experience into truth.
